Chinese authorities have issued a warning regarding security vulnerabilities in Anthropic's Claude Code, alleging the tool contains a 'back-door' that could leak sensitive user data. This follows ongoing tensions between U.S. AI firms and Chinese tech companies over data security and access.

BEIJING — China on Wednesday warned of "back-door" security risks affecting companies that use U.S.-based company Anthropic's Claude Code artificial intelligence tool.
